What Is Predictive UX?
Predictive UX uses artificial intelligence, machine learning, and behavioural data to forecast user intent and deliver proactive experiences. Instead of waiting for users to search, click, or navigate manually, predictive systems anticipate what users are likely to need next.
This can include:
- Personalised content recommendations
- Predictive search suggestions
- Automated product or service recommendations
- Dynamic interface adjustments based on behaviour

How AI Understands User Behaviour
Predictive UX relies heavily on behavioural data and machine learning algorithms. AI analyses patterns such as browsing history, click behaviour, time spent on pages, and previous interactions to predict future actions.
Key data sources include:
- User navigation patterns
- Purchase and browsing history
- Interaction timing and frequency
- Search behaviour and preferences

Predictive Search and Content Discovery
Search experiences are evolving rapidly through AI-powered prediction. Modern search systems no longer depend entirely on exact keywords. Instead, they understand intent and context.
Predictive search capabilities include:
- Autocomplete suggestions based on behaviour
- Context-aware recommendations
- Natural language understanding
This creates faster and more intuitive interactions, helping users find what they need with minimal effort.
Balancing Personalisation with Privacy
While predictive UX relies on user data, businesses must balance personalisation with transparency and trust. Users increasingly expect privacy-conscious experiences and clear data practices.
Best practices include:
- Using consent-based data collection
- Being transparent about AI-driven recommendations
- Prioritising secure data handling
